What Is Eugenol?
Eugenol is a naturally occurring terpene that matters to cannabinoid brands because aroma, sensory profile and formulation stability can strongly influence the finished product experience. Professional buyers usually evaluate terpenes through source, purity, batch consistency, carrier compatibility and intended market route rather than aroma description alone.
In cannabinoid products, eugenol may be used to support a specific flavour or fragrance direction in oils, vapes, edibles, topical formats or terpene blends. The right specification depends on the application, the permitted use category and the documentation required by the buyerās quality team.
Where it fits in cannabinoid product development
Terpenes can help create a recognisable profile for a finished product, but they also introduce technical questions. Buyers should check volatility, oxidation behaviour, allergen declarations, sensory impact, permitted concentration and packaging compatibility before moving from sample evaluation to production.
Quality and sourcing checks
- Request batch-specific documentation for identity, purity and relevant contaminant screening.
- Confirm whether the material is natural, nature-identical or synthetic, depending on the intended product route.
- Review storage guidance, shelf life and packaging to reduce oxidation risk.
- Test the terpene in the actual finished-product matrix before approving scale-up.

| Explore the Essence and Uses of Eugenol Definition of Eugenol Eugenol is a naturally occurring compound predominantly found in essential oils, especially in clove oil, basil, and cinnamon. It is recognized for its aromatic properties and potential applications in multiple industries. In-Depth Explanation of Eugenol Eugenol, historically extracted from clove oil, plays a significant role in traditional wellness product and modern industries. This compound was first isolated in 1842 and has since been explored for various uses due to its aromatic and therapeutic characteristics. In the scientific community, eugenol is noted for its chemical structure known as phenolic ether.

Documentation package to prepare
A useful documentation package may include a certificate of analysis, specification sheet, batch reference, contaminant screening, storage guidance and product description. Finished products may also require ingredient information, label-support details and packaging data.
The correct package depends on product category and destination market. Buyers should confirm whether internal quality teams, distributors or import partners need additional information before shipment or launch.
